April 03, 2014
CFTC Asks 2nd Circ. To Uphold Subpoenas In Oil Futures Suit
The U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ission asked the Second Circuit on Wednesday to uphold a lower court's decision allowing for the disclosure of sensitive documents related to crude oil futures trading by Shell Oil Co. and other companies in a proposed class action alleging market manipulation, saying increased restrictions on its subpoena power would be dangerous and unwarranted.

January 03, 2014
2nd Circ. Asked To Nix Doc Disclosure In Oil Futures Suit
Shell Oil Co., Morgan Stanley Capital Group Inc. and Plains All American Pipeline LP told the Second Circuit on Thursday that a lower court exceeded its authority in allowing the disclosure of sensitive documents provided to federal investigators in a proposed class action alleging certain oil traders manipulated the crude futures market.
